JUSTICES OF THE PEACE.

Several remits were adopted for for- [ warding to the annual Federation conference at the adjourned annual meeting of the Auckland Justices of the Peace Association last evening, at which tho president, Mr. V. A. Coyle, presided. The following officers were elected: — President, Mr. V. A. Coyle; vicepresidents, Mrs. X. M. Moles\vor*», Messrs. I). Donaldson and .T. B. I'atei - son; council, Mrs. M. M. Droaver, .Mi*s A. Basten. Messrs. A. I'osser, A. J. Stratford, G. Magee, J. W. Bissett. Mrs. Molesworth is the first lady vicepresident to bo clectcd by the Auckland Association.
